CNNC Completes Erection of Two Steam Generators for Unit 1 of Sanmen Nuclear Power Project

Researched by Industrial Info Resources China (Beijing, China)--The second steam generator for Unit 1 of China National Nuclear Corporation's (CNNC) (Beijing) Sanmen Nuclear Power Project was lifted into its final position on January 10, 2013. The two steam generators for the unit now have been fully completed, according to an announcement from CNNC on January 15, 2013.

As reported, the erected steam generator, with a total weight of more than 600 metric tons, is the largest and heaviest equipment in the unit. The completion of the generators has created a favorable condition for the enveloping of the steel-made container vessel for the unit in the next stage, which means that the construction of the nuclear island for the unit has entered a peak season.

The Sanmen Nuclear Power Plant, located in Sanmen of East China's Zhejiang province, is one of the two self-reliant support projects for the localization of Westinghouse's AP1000 third-generation nuclear technology in China. The power plant has a total planned capacity of six 1,250-megawatt (MW) nuclear power units that are to be built in three phases, including two AP1000-based nuclear power units are to be built in Phase I. State Nuclear Power Technology Corporation (Beijing) is serving as the general contractor on the project. China Nuclear Industry Fifth Construction Company Limited (Shanghai, China) is serving as the construction general contractor.

Construction of the nuclear island for Unit 1 of Sanmen Nuclear Power Plant kicked off in March 2009. Concrete placing for the conventional island of Unit 1 was completed on January 28, 2011. Erection of the generator for Unit 1 began on September 10, 2012. According to the schedule, units 1 and 2 of the project will be put into service in 2013 and 2014, respectively.
